Lake Highlands Neighborhood Shocked by Homicide

Relative found man dead in his apartment Tuesday morning

Neighbors in a Lake Highlands community are on edge after hearing a man was found murdered inside his home.

52-year-old William Dale Martin was found dead inside his apartment on Tuesday morning. Neighbors say a relative was coming to pick him up for breakfast when his body was discovered.

The Dallas County Medical Examiner ruled his death a homicide and said he suffered sharp injuries to his face, neck and arms.

Martin's neighbor, Rita Barnes, says he was the type of guy who struck up a conversation with everyone around him. She last saw and spoke with Martin on Sunday.

“We didn’t talk about anything important, just, 'hey, how are you?'” Barnes said.

Another neighbor, Frederick Scott, says the neighbors are shaken up after hearing of his death.

“When they said, 'Dale, someone killed him,' that was a big shock. He doesn’t bother anyone,” said Scott.

Police say robbery may be a possible motive as several items were stolen from his apartment. Investigators did not elaborate on what those items were.
